    This reminds me of the story where Harry Smith failed a drugs test in developmental and Vince McMahon put him on Raw for a few weeks, just so he could suspend someone on their main roster to prove that he was serious about drug testing. So would WWE script a fake choking angle just so they could "shoot" fire somebody who "went into business for themselves" to prove that they were serious about keeping their content PG? Just one possible silly conspiracy theory...

    I don't really understand how Bryan got screwed by being shoot fired. Even though the NXT invasion angle got off to such a great start, so did the Spirit Squad and the NXT guys are a lot greener than they were. In the long run the odds are strong that either the WWE script writers will quickly botch the angle because they don't know how to and are unwilling to book an effective long term outsiders angle or Triple H returns, moans that none of these guys knows how to work and sends them all packing back to Florida. Meanwhile Bryan's sitting pretty, being paid to sit at home for three months and can then milk the indy circuit dry, while waiting for this storm in a teacup to blow over and WWE inevitably decides to bring him back. If, in the unlikely scenario that this angle is a big success, WWE can always slot him back into the feud a few months down the line.

    Yeah, John Cena, as per WWE's orders, uses Twitter as his fictional wrestling character would use it, to sell his WWE storylines as being real. Dave made fun a few days ago about Cena pretending to have a mild concussion and then when realizing it would be against WWE's Wellness policy to work this weekend's house shows as he was scheduled to do so, then having to pretend that he underwent an impact testing program and was cleared to wrestle by his doctors. Given his earlier cryptic cranky news update, maybe Dave knows more than he can officially let on?
